免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果ipa企业签名怎么做

苹果的ipa企业签名是指通过企业开发者账号签名的方式,将ipa文件安装到非App Store上的设备上。这种方式适用于开发者或企业内部分发应用给员工使用,无需通过App Store审核和发布。

下面详细介绍一下苹果ipa企业签名的原理和具体步骤:

1. 原理:

苹果在设备上安装应用程序时,会对应用进行数字签名验证,以确保应用来源可信。企业签名则是通过专门的企业开发者账号为应用进行签名,使之被苹果设备所信任,从而能够在非App Store上进行安装和使用。

2. 步骤:

(1)获取企业开发者账号:

首先需要拥有一个企业开发者账号,这个账号可以通过在苹果开发者中心注册获得。注册成功后,你将获得一个用于签名和分发企业应用的证书。

(2)创建应用签名:

在企业开发者账号中,选择证书、标识和配置文件页面,创建一个用于应用签名的分发证书。根据指引下载并安装证书,然后将其导入到钥匙串中。

(3)创建App ID:

在相同页面中创建一个App ID,这个ID将用于唯一标识你的应用。确保该App ID与你要签名的应用的Bundle Identifier相对应。

(4)生成描述文件:

在证书、标识和配置文件页面中,选择配置文件,创建一个新的企业分发描述文件。选择你的App ID和证书,下载并安装描述文件。

(5)打包应用程序:

使用Xcode或其他相关工具,将你的应用程序打包成.ipa文件。确保选择正确的签名证书和分发配置文件。

(6)签名应用:

打开终端,使用命令行工具codesign对应用进行签名。例如:

codesign -s "Your Certificate" -f /path/to/YourApp.app

(7)部署应用:

将签名后的.ipa文件上传到一个可供下载的服务器上,以便用户可以通过URL访问和安装应用。

(8)安装应用:

在iOS设备上访问应用的下载地址,点击下载并安装应用。首次安装时可能需要信任企业开发者账号。

以上为苹果ipa企业签名的详细步骤和原理介绍,希望对你有所帮助。请注意,企业签名只适用于企业内部应用分发,不得用于商业化或大规模分发。


相关知识:
苹果软件删除企业签名
在开始介绍如何删除苹果软件的企业签名之前,让我们先来了解一下什么是企业签名以及它的作用。企业签名是一种数字证书,用于将开发者的身份与特定的应用程序绑定在一起。通过给应用程序添加企业签名,开发者可以在没有通过App Store的情况下,将其分发给其他设备安装
2023-07-20
苹果p12文件证书
标题:苹果P12文件证书详解:原理、生成和应用导言:在苹果生态系统中,P12文件证书被广泛应用于身份验证和加密通信等方面。本文将详细介绍P12文件证书的原理、生成方法以及在苹果设备上的应用。第一部分:P12文件证书的原理P12文件是苹果用于存储私钥和数字证
2023-07-18
手机能申请p12证书吗
可以用手机申请P12证书。下面将介绍P12证书的定义、手机申请P12证书的原理和详细步骤。1. P12证书的定义P12证书也称为PKCS12证书,是一种数字证书,常用于身份验证、加密和解密以及数字签名等领域。它采用公钥加密技术和私钥加密技术保障网络通信的安
2023-07-18
linux怎么导入p12证书
在Linux系统中,我们可以使用openssl工具来导入p12证书。P12证书通常包含了公钥、私钥和所有的中间证书,用于在SSL/TLS连接中进行身份验证和加密通信。下面是详细的步骤。1. 打开终端。2. 使用以下命令导入p12证书: ``` op
2023-07-18
ipa最新的认证书图片
IPA(International Phonetic Association)国际音标协会认证是全球语音学领域最有权威性的认证之一。该认证证明了申请者对国际音标的掌握程度,对于从事语言学、音韵学等相关领域研究的学者和教师来说很有价值。下面将详细介绍IPA认
2023-07-18
mt管理器的apk签名在哪
APK签名是一种确保应用程序的完整性和来源可信性的技术手段。在Android系统中,每个APK文件都需要进行签名,以便系统能够验证应用程序的身份和完整性。MT管理器是一款非常受欢迎的文件管理工具,这里将介绍一下MT管理器的APK签名原理和详细过程。1. A
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4